logo

本地化AI赋能:DeepSeek模型本地部署全流程指南

作者:新兰2025.09.26 17:15浏览量:0

简介:本文详细解析DeepSeek大语言模型本地部署的全流程,涵盖硬件配置、环境搭建、模型优化及安全策略,提供从单机到集群的部署方案及故障排查指南,助力企业构建自主可控的AI能力。

一、本地部署DeepSeek的核心价值与适用场景

在AI技术快速迭代的背景下,本地化部署大语言模型已成为企业构建差异化竞争力的关键路径。DeepSeek作为开源的先进语言模型,其本地部署不仅能保障数据主权,还能通过定制化优化显著提升业务效率。

1.1 数据安全与合规性

医疗、金融等受监管行业对数据存储位置有严格限制。本地部署可确保训练数据和推理结果完全存储于企业内网,避免跨境传输风险。例如某三甲医院通过本地化部署,在满足《个人信息保护法》要求的同时,实现了病历摘要生成的自动化。

1.2 业务连续性保障

公有云服务存在网络波动和服务中断风险。本地部署通过物理隔离架构,可确保7×24小时稳定运行。某制造业企业部署后,将设备故障预测模型的响应时间从云端3.2秒压缩至本地0.8秒,年减少停机损失超千万元。

1.3 定制化能力开发

本地环境支持模型微调、知识注入等深度定制。某电商平台基于本地DeepSeek模型,构建了行业专属的商品推荐系统,点击率提升27%,转化率提升19%。这种定制化能力是标准化云服务难以实现的。

二、硬件配置与性能优化策略

2.1 基础硬件选型指南

组件 推荐配置 成本优化方案
GPU NVIDIA A100 80GB×4(推理) 考虑二手V100或租赁云GPU
CPU AMD EPYC 7763(64核) 双路Xeon Platinum 8380
内存 512GB DDR4 ECC 分阶段扩容,首期256GB
存储 NVMe SSD RAID 0(2TB×4) 混合存储:SSD+HDD分层架构

2.2 性能优化实战技巧

  • 显存优化:采用TensorRT量化技术,将FP32模型转换为INT8,显存占用降低75%,推理速度提升3倍。
  • 并行计算:使用DeepSpeed的ZeRO-3技术,在4卡A100环境下实现175B参数模型的训练,内存占用减少80%。
  • 批处理策略:动态批处理算法可根据请求负载自动调整batch_size,在保证延迟<500ms的前提下,吞吐量提升40%。

三、部署实施全流程解析

3.1 环境搭建三步法

  1. 基础环境准备

    1. # Ubuntu 22.04 LTS系统优化
    2. sudo apt update && sudo apt install -y build-essential cmake git
    3. sudo sysctl -w vm.swappiness=10
    4. echo "fs.file-max = 6553500" >> /etc/sysctl.conf
  2. 依赖库安装

    1. # PyTorch 2.0+CUDA 11.8安装
    2. pip3 install torch torchvision --extra-index-url https://download.pytorch.org/whl/cu118
    3. # DeepSeek专用依赖
    4. pip install deepseek-core transformers==4.35.0
  3. 模型加载与验证

    1. from deepseek import AutoModelForCausalLM
    2. model = AutoModelForCausalLM.from_pretrained("deepseek-7b")
    3. model.eval() # 切换至推理模式

3.2 集群部署架构设计

对于千亿参数级模型,推荐采用”1+N”混合架构:

  • 主节点:负责模型加载和任务调度(建议双机热备)
  • 计算节点:通过gRPC实现模型分片并行计算
  • 存储节点:采用Ceph分布式存储系统,确保模型检查点的高可用性

四、安全防护体系构建

4.1 三层防御机制

  1. 网络层:部署下一代防火墙(NGFW),配置DDoS防护阈值≥10Gbps
  2. 应用层:实现API网关鉴权,采用JWT令牌+IP白名单双重验证
  3. 数据层:对存储的模型权重进行AES-256加密,密钥管理采用HSM硬件模块

4.2 审计与监控方案

  • 日志系统:集成ELK Stack,设置异常访问报警规则
  • 性能监控:使用Prometheus+Grafana监控GPU利用率、内存泄漏等关键指标
  • 模型漂移检测:每月执行一次基准测试,对比输出质量变化

五、故障排查与维护指南

5.1 常见问题解决方案

现象 可能原因 解决方案
推理延迟>1s 显存不足 启用梯度检查点或降低batch_size
输出结果不一致 随机种子未固定 在代码开头添加torch.manual_seed(42)
模型加载失败 CUDA版本不匹配 重新编译PyTorch或降级CUDA版本

5.2 持续优化路线图

  1. 季度更新:跟踪DeepSeek官方模型升级,评估是否需要替换
  2. 半年优化:根据业务数据分布,实施领域自适应微调
  3. 年度重构:评估硬件迭代,制定升级计划(如从A100升级至H100)

六、行业应用案例解析

6.1 智能制造场景

某汽车厂商部署本地DeepSeek后,实现:

  • 维修手册自动生成:准确率92%,效率提升5倍
  • 设备故障预测:提前72小时预警,误报率<3%
  • 供应链优化:需求预测MAPE降低至8.7%

6.2 智慧医疗实践

三甲医院应用方案:

  • 电子病历智能审核:审核时间从15分钟/份缩短至90秒
  • 临床决策支持:基于本地知识库的诊疗建议采纳率达81%
  • 医学影像报告生成:结构化报告生成时间<8秒

结语:本地部署DeepSeek是构建企业级AI能力的战略选择,通过科学的硬件规划、严谨的实施流程和完善的运维体系,可实现安全、高效、定制化的AI应用。建议企业从试点项目入手,逐步扩大部署规模,最终形成完整的AI技术栈。”

相关文章推荐

发表评论

活动